Arrested by the Inquisition, Bruno was convicted of heresy and eventually burned at the stake years before Galileo's famous trial. Yet even death could not stem the growing tide of this brilliant thinker's influence--a philosophy that inspired some of the greatest minds in history, including Galileo, Newton, Spinoza, and even Shakespeare. |
